Meta $META launched Muse Spark 1.1, its strongest AI coding model yet, to compete with Anthropic Claude Code and OpenAI Codex. Meta priced it at $1.25 per million input tokens and $4.25 per million output tokens, undercutting rivals in a market Anthropic has led.
SpaceX $SPCX posted 92% revenue growth to $7.81B in its first earnings report since going public, but capex jumped 2,013% year over year to $15.8B. The stock fell about 8% in extended trading. Anthropic pays SpaceX $1.25B a month for AI compute through 2029.
An estimated 3,000 to 5,000 migrants remain camped on a beach in Ceuta a week after roughly 72,000 crossed from Morocco, Spain's largest surge, per CNN and CBC. The death toll: 72 on the Spanish side, 11 Moroccan. Among those remaining are 862 unaccompanied minors, who cannot be deported.

Zero of the 24 ballistic missiles Russia fired at Kyiv overnight were intercepted, per CNN. At least 17 were killed, 44 injured as the barrage, which included 115 drones, hit warehouses of Epicentr, Rozetka, Nova Poshta and Fozzy Group, per NPR. The miss signals thinning Ukrainian air defenses.
Microsoft $MSFT unveiled Project Perception, agentic AI (Red, Blue, Green) that find, prioritize and patch vulnerabilities. Its new MAI-Cyber-1-Flash model, paired with GPT-5.4, scored 95.95% on the CyberGym exploit benchmark vs about 83% for rivals, per Axios.
Nvidia $NVDA is weighing over $750 billion in AI financing deals and partnerships, per Bloomberg via Axios, including a discussed $250 billion guarantee for an OpenAI data center. Nvidia already paid $20 billion for AI chip startup Groq in December.
China has begun mass-producing homegrown immersion DUV lithography machines, per The Information and Tom's Hardware. First units land at SMIC, Hua Hong and CXMT this year: about 5 machines in 2026, 20 in 2027. Some parts still come from Japan. ASML $ASML alone ships roughly 130 a year.
Two people have died and at least 98 have been hospitalized in a Cyclospora outbreak linked to iceberg lettuce served at Taco Bell locations across nine states, the CDC says. Taylor Farms de Mexico recalled the lettuce July 17. Both deaths involved underlying health conditions, per CDC.
Matcha's trendy, but daily drinkers are rare. A Statista Consumer Insights survey of 1,000 Americans found just 9% of people in their 20s and 30s drink matcha regularly, 8% of those in their 40s, and 4% aged 50-64. Most who know it have only tried it. Source: Statista.
Real GDP growth rate, % for 2025: Spain 2.8%, EU27 1.4%, France 0.8%, Italy 0.5%, Germany 0.2%. Source: Eurostat.
A Russian drone hunted a vegetable vendor at his Kherson market stall, chasing him around his van before exploding as he dove for cover. He survived with shrapnel wounds. Ukrainian police released the footage, accusing Russia of a war crime. Reuters verified the location via satellite imagery.
South Korea's Yangsan hit 42.5C Sunday, the highest temperature in the country's 122 years of weather records. President Lee Jae-myung declared the heatwave a national disaster Tuesday after 19 deaths, and Seoul just received its first-ever severe heat wave warning. Per Korea Herald, AP.
German Finance Minister Klingbeil is reviving a plan to scrap the one-year tax-free holding period for crypto gains in the 2027 budget draft, Cointelegraph reports. Crypto taxed like stocks: 25% plus surcharge, any holding time. Goal: 2bn euros. Merz's CDU/CSU has resisted the idea before.
UBS $UBS Financial Services hit with $125M in US penalties from FinCEN, FINRA and CFTC for willful Bank Secrecy Act violations, the largest ever against a broker-dealer. Failed to vet high-risk clients tied to Russia and Latin America, 2019-2023. Fined $14.5M for similar failures in 2018.
HP, Asus and Acer have begun using small amounts of DRAM from China's CXMT in select budget laptops sold outside the US, Nikkei Asia reports, as an AI-driven memory shortage squeezes supply. Chips stay off US models, makers wary of upsetting suppliers Micron $MU, Samsung and SK Hynix.
Trump admin drafting ban on new Chinese optical transceivers in US data centers, per Reuters, citing malware, data theft risk. Targets Zhongji Innolight, on Pentagon's China military list since June. Rivals Lumentum $LITE, Coherent $COHR up 7-11%.
Snap $SNAP posted Q2 2026 revenue of $1.6 billion, up 19% year over year and beating estimates by $60 million. Net loss narrowed to $164 million from $262.6 million. Shares rose 17.3%. Most growth came from subscriptions and other revenue, up 85%; core advertising grew just 9%.
Palantir $PLTR posted 93% revenue growth in Q2 2026 to $1.94 billion, with US commercial revenue up 149% to $764 million. Stock jumped 12% after hours. The company builds no large language models of its own; growth comes from linking enterprise data to other firms' AI.
The White House meets Anthropic, OpenAI, Google $GOOGL and other AI firms Tuesday to review a new voluntary framework: labs would give the government access to their most advanced unreleased models for up to 30 days to test cybersecurity risks before public launch.
UK Department for Education confirms hackers stole roughly 607,000 records, names, job titles, emails and phone numbers of school leaders, university staff and officials, after breaching its help desk and Turing Scheme portals. Group ExfilSquad published the data and demanded payment.
Every organization still running an unpatched SonicWall SMA 1000 VPN appliance is a target right now. INC ransomware is the dominant group exploiting CVE-2026-15409, a maximum-severity (CVSS 10) flaw giving root access without credentials. Patched July 14; exploited since June 22.
China leads global humanoid robot investment with $4.4B poured into startups since 2017, edging the US at $3B, according to Tracxn data via Statista. 2025 alone drew over $3B, more than 2017-2024 combined. Unitree and Agibot each shipped 5,000+ units last year.
CO2 emissions per capita, tonnes in 2024: United States 14.2t, Russia 12.3t, China 8.7t, Germany 6.8t, Brazil 2.3t, India 2.2t. Source: Global Carbon Budget (2025); Population based on various sources (2024) – with major processing by Our World in Data.
Australian officials warn H5N1 bird flu is likely to spread further after the country's first mass mortality event from the virus: 49 dead and 35 sick greater crested terns found on rocks off Cape Jaffa, South Australia, per Al Jazeera and US News.
Ukraine's HUR used modified Magura naval drones to strike Russian ground targets in occupied Crimea for the first time, hitting a Podlet radar command vehicle and a Parol-4 IFF interrogator, per Kyiv Independent and Ukrainska Pravda. The drones had previously only hit ships and aircraft.
Every person alive today carries DNA from two extinct human relatives science did not know existed. A new method called TRACE found a ghost lineage that interbred with humans in Africa over 50,000 years ago, and a super-archaic lineage from 1.8 million years ago tied to Denisovans. Per Science.
A study published in Science Advances found that moonquakes can reveal buried water ice at the lunar south pole before any drilling. Seismic waves move two to three times faster through icy soil, letting researchers map ice down to 2,625 feet deep. NASA is eyeing the region for crewed landings.
Apple is suing OpenAI in California federal court, alleging former engineer Chang Liu exploited an unknown authentication bug to keep pulling confidential hardware files from Apple's internal cloud storage for weeks after leaving for OpenAI $AAPL. Apple says it has since patched the flaw.
